Why Insurers Say No and What to Do
Some denials come from policy limits, missed details, or perceived fault questions. Companies may also use automated systems that slow responses and clarity. Studies indicate checking the police report and photos helps challenge unfair decisions. Gather records, notes, and witness contacts quickly to protect your path forward.
One-line takeaway: Document details, review your own policy, and ask questions to respond to a denial.
Common Questions
H3: Can I still get money if the other driver’s insurance denied me?
A: Yes, you may use your own coverage, such as medical payments or uninsured motorist, if your policy allows it.
H3: How fast should I act after receiving a denial letter?
A: Contact your insurer and a local lawyer promptly, because deadlines for reviews or appeals can be very short.
